First KC-130R for JMSDF undergoing regeneration at Hill AFB

The first of six KC-130R for the Japanese Maritime Self Defense Force has started its regeneration at Hill Air Force Base and work will complete in fall of 2013.

Structural modifications being performed on all six aircraft include the replacement of landing gear supports, cargo door supports, center wing rainbow fittings and corrosion repair. In addition to structural modifications, Japan will receive thirty overhauled T56-A-16 engines and digital cockpit upgrades to include a digital GPS.
